Summary

SIE Sound Team's ' "The King's Curse" was released on its scheduled release date, January 11, 2001. The duration of This song is about two minutes long, specifically at 2:13. This song does not appear to have any foul language. The King's Curse's duration is considered a little bit shorter than the average duration of a typical track. The song is number 32 out of 46 in Dark Cloud Original Soundtrack by SIE Sound Team. In terms of popularity, The King's Curse is currently not that popular. Even with the track produces more of a neutral energy, it is pretty danceable compared to others.

The King's Curse BPM

The tempo marking of The King's Curse by SIE Sound Team is Andante (at a walking pace), since this song has a tempo of 90 BPM. With that information, we can conclude that the song has a slow tempo. This song can go great with yoga or pilates. The time signature for this track is 4/4.
